Ronald de Boer insists that Memphis Depay still has the potential to be a "superstar" despite a disappointment debut season at Manchester United.

The 22-year-old arrived at Old Trafford last summer for a reported fee of £25m, but struggled to establish himself in the first team and soon fell out of favour with manager Louis van Gaal.

Memphis made just four league starts after the turn of the year and was left out of the squad entirely for the FA Cup final on Saturday, but De Boer believes that his compatriot just needs time to adapt.

"Memphis is still a young lad and he has to adapt. Sometimes it takes one or two years. I'm sure he has the quality to be a superstar. He can really do it," he is quoted as saying by PA.

The former PSV Eindhoven winger scored just two league goals in 29 games for United this season.
